Palletways are looking to appoint a Night Operations Health and Safety Manager to join the Night Operations Team reporting to the General Manager, Night Hub Operations with a dotted line to the UK SHEQ Manager. Based at Lichfield, working permanent nights, the purpose of the role is to support the General Manager, Night Hub Operations in all matters of Safety, Health, Environmental, and Quality.

How to prepare for a job interview at Palletways

Know Your Safety Standards

Familiarise yourself with the latest health and safety regulations relevant to night operations. Be prepared to discuss how you would implement these standards in a practical setting, as this will show your commitment to maintaining a safe working environment.

Demonstrate Leadership Skills

As a Night Operations Health and Safety Manager, you'll need to lead by example. Think of specific instances where you've successfully managed a team or resolved conflicts. Share these examples during your interview to highlight your leadership capabilities.

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ect questions that put you in hypothetical situations related to health and safety. Practice your responses to scenarios like handling an emergency or addressing non-compliance. This will help you articulate your thought process and decision-making skills effectively.
